LORAIN - Janice Elaine Riley, 52, of Lorain, passed away Tuesday, December 10, 2013 at her home.

Janice, known to many as Elaine, was born on June 17, 1961 in Lorain, Ohio and was a graduate of Admiral King High School.

She worked as a phlebotomist for Life Share before retiring.

Elaine enjoyed attending various churches, reading and studying her bible, watching movies with her sons, and playing games with her family members.

Elaine is survived by her two sons, Jaynethan and Tyron Riley of Lorain; a grandson, Cameron Riley of Lorain; her parents, Ulysess and Ella Riley of Lorain; sisters, Rosa Hall (Fredrick) of Detroit MI and Marilyn Riley of Lorain; brothers, Robert Riley of Detroit MI, General Brown and Alexander Henderson, both of Lorain; aunts, Flora Anthony of Chicago IL and Rosie Pope of Lorain; and a host of other beloved family members.

She was preceded in death by two sisters, Gloria Ann Riley and Elizabeth Riley-Mays.

Visitation will be held Saturday, December 21, 2013 from 10:00 a.m. until time of service at 11:00 a.m. at New Bethel Primitive Baptist Church, 3880 Dayton Ave., Lorain OH 44052.

Pastor Tyrone Holley will officiate. Interment will follow in Elmwood Cemetery, Lorain.

Professional services entrusted to Brown-Robinson Funeral Home, 2652 Broadway Ave., Lorain OH 44052.

Published in The Morning Journal on Dec. 18, 2013
